Gateway Awards
The Gateway Awards were created in 2000, but their first official year was 2003-04.
They are created and administered by the Missouri Association of School Librarians (MASL).
15 books are nominated each year, selected for readers in ninth through twelfth grades.
Student must read 3 of the 15 titles in order to vote.
Students can vote at their school library in March, with proof that they have read 3 titles. (Check with your school librarian for more information.)
The winner is announced at the Missouri Association of School Librarians (MASL) Conference in April.
Gateway Award Nominees for 2008-2009
- Just Listen by Sarah Dessen
- Copper Sun by Draper, Sharon
- The Christopher Killer by Ferguson, Alane
- Diva by Flinn, Alex
- What Happened To Cass McBride by Giles, Gail
- Born To Rock by Korman, Gordon
- Hattie Big Sky by Larson, Kirby
- Sold by McCormick, Patricia
- Life As We Knew It by Pfeffer, Susan Beth
- Terrier: The Legend of Beka Cooper #1 by Pierce, Tamora
- Dead Connection by Price, Charlie
- A Brief Chapter In My Impossible Life by Reinhardt, Dana
- Notes From the Midnight Driver by Sonnenblick, Jordan
- Rooftop by Volponi, Paul
- Rules of Survival by Werlin, Nancy
